Finding Reliable Halal Chicken Suppliers

Securing a dependable supply of authentic halal chicken is essential for any business. To verify compliance, begin by carefully investigating potential providers. Look for suppliers with recognized and credible halal certifications from a well-known Islamic organization or body. Don't hesitate to ask for their auditing process and traceability documentation – verifying the chain of custody from farm to kitchen is essential. Consider suppliers who offer detailed information on their farming practices, slaughtering methods, and handling procedures; transparency builds trust. Finally, consistently perform your own due diligence, potentially including independent verification or site visits, to confirm their commitment to halal standards.

Processed Fowl Islamic Approval Explained

Understanding here processed fowl permissible certification can be difficult for buyers. Basically, it's a procedure that ensures the fowl has been processed according to stringent Sharia guidelines. This includes everything from the raising of the birds and slaughtering methods to preservation conditions. Halal certifying organizations like ABC Islamic Certification conduct inspections of the entire supply chain, from farm to table. Identify a valid certification mark on the branding to be certain you're purchasing food that is suitable.

Sourcing Halal Frozen Chicken: Wholesale Options

Finding reputable sources for wholesale permissible frozen chicken can be a hurdle, especially when consistent quality and affordable pricing are crucial. Many enterprises, from restaurants to retail outlets, need a dependable supplier offering bulk quantities of certified halal frozen poultry. Several options exist; you can consider contacting directly importers, specialized distributors or even manufacturers who offer direct-to-business solutions. Prioritizing suppliers with verifiable Halal certification – look for organizations like JAKIM, MUI, or similar bodies – is necessary to guarantee adherence to Islamic dietary laws. Furthermore, investigating their cold chain management and storage practices ensures the chicken remains fresh and safe throughout shipment and delivery. Negotiating pricing and minimum order requirements is key when procuring in large volumes; building a long-term relationship with a trusted provider often yields better deals.
